Output e35a3f46a084c5e4e9437b0afcdc6fa0d48a70f695b067c22b846686193cae62:35

value
145512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af87428c986495b46ff3e5b4e75f21ef8a4c3194 OP_EQUAL
address
3Hh8D97apPXMvjtUtATU3UnLAcaoLTcpVh
transaction
e35a3f46a084c5e4e9437b0afcdc6fa0d48a70f695b067c22b846686193cae62
spent
true